| |
 | Gut zu wissen: Hilfreiche Tipps und Tricks aus der Praxis prägnant, und auf den Punkt gebracht für Autodesk Produkte |
| |
 | Von Digital Twins bis Hochleistungs-Computing: PNY präsentiert seine Zukunftstechnologien für die Industrie von morgen, eine Pressemitteilung
|
Autor
|
Thema: .xlsx mit iLogic erzeugen (1117 / mal gelesen)
|
8023 Mitglied
 Beiträge: 3 Registriert: 07.09.2022 Inventor 2022
|
erstellt am: 07. Sep. 2022 08:29 <-- editieren / zitieren --> Unities abgeben:         
|
Roland Schröder Moderator Dr.-Ing. Maschinenbau, Entwicklung & Konstruktion von Spezialmaschinen
       

 Beiträge: 13694 Registriert: 02.04.2004 IV 2025.3.1
|
erstellt am: 07. Sep. 2022 11:07 <-- editieren / zitieren --> Unities abgeben:          Nur für 8023
|
8023 Mitglied
 Beiträge: 3 Registriert: 07.09.2022 Inventor 2022
|
erstellt am: 07. Sep. 2022 11:34 <-- editieren / zitieren --> Unities abgeben:         
Moin.. ich möchte einige Eigenschaften aus einer .asm .iam heraus in eine Excel exportieren um sie bei der Zeichnung wieder einfügen zu können. Allerding existiert die .xlsx normal nicht und die Regel wirft einen Fehler. Dann muss ich diese extra manuell erstellen... das nerft Deshalb möchte das die Regel machen lassen. [Diese Nachricht wurde von 8023 am 07. Sep. 2022 editiert.]
[Diese Nachricht wurde von 8023 am 07. Sep. 2022 editiert.]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
rkauskh Moderator Dipl.-Ing. (FH) Versorgungstechnik, Master Eng. IT-Security & Forensic
      

 Beiträge: 2912 Registriert: 15.11.2006 Windows 10 x64, AIP 2020-2025
|
erstellt am: 07. Sep. 2022 14:05 <-- editieren / zitieren --> Unities abgeben:          Nur für 8023
Hallo Warunm öffnest du nicht die Zeichnung (dabei wird die Assembly im Hintergrund mit geöffnet) und kopierst die Daten direkt? Ich verstehe den Sinn des Umweges nicht. So könnte man es mit Excel machen:
Code:
myXLS_File = "C:\Temp\Test.xlsx" excelApp = CreateObject("Excel.Application") excelApp.DisplayAlerts = FalseIf Dir(myXLS_File) <> "" Then excelWorkbook = excelApp.Workbooks.Open(myXLS_File) ExcelSheet = excelWorkbook.Worksheets(1) Else excelWorkbook = excelApp.Workbooks.Add End If With excelApp .Range("A1").Select .ActiveCell.FormulaR1C1 = iProperties.Value("Project", "Part Number") End With excelApp.Columns.AutoFit excelWorkbook.SaveAs (myXLS_File) excelWorkbook.Close excelApp.Quit excelApp = Nothing
------------------ MfG Ralf RKW Solutions GmbH www.RKW-Solutions.com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
8023 Mitglied
 Beiträge: 3 Registriert: 07.09.2022 Inventor 2022
|
erstellt am: 07. Sep. 2022 15:19 <-- editieren / zitieren --> Unities abgeben:         
 ich finde iLogic recht anstrengend dokumentiert (oder ich hab die Doku noch nicht gefunden  ) und bin froh, dass es macht was es soll, was ich mir an Codeschnippseln zusammengeklau(b)t hab ich schau mir das heut Abend mal an, Danke für eure Mühen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
rkauskh Moderator Dipl.-Ing. (FH) Versorgungstechnik, Master Eng. IT-Security & Forensic
      

 Beiträge: 2912 Registriert: 15.11.2006 Windows 10 x64, AIP 2020-2025
|
erstellt am: 07. Sep. 2022 22:18 <-- editieren / zitieren --> Unities abgeben:          Nur für 8023
|